Output 4feadbb2b42f2d8fd3dc0c296de79e4615b4c1fa72f3b310dd2b0f5812d1e864:21

value
693336
script pubkey
OP_0 OP_PUSHBYTES_20 073e44e549907582468790b64bed760319a4f681
address
bc1qqulyfe2fjp6cy358jzmyhmtkqvv6fa5ple7p4l
transaction
4feadbb2b42f2d8fd3dc0c296de79e4615b4c1fa72f3b310dd2b0f5812d1e864
confirmations
80392
spent
true